LVP flooring is designed to mimic the look of hardwood, stone, or tile while offering a more resilient alternative. This flooring material is made from several layers, which include a wear layer, a vinyl layer, and often a backing layer. These components contribute to the overall strength and durability of the product.
One of the most significant factors in determining whether LVP flooring is suitable for your home is understanding its weight capacity. On average, LVP flooring can support around 300 pounds (about 136 kg) per square foot. This means that a standard LVP plank can handle considerable weight without bending or warping.

LVP flooring is engineered for longevity. Its multiple layers, particularly the wear layer, resist scratches, dents, and stains. This makes it an ideal choice for high-traffic areas or homes with pets. Moreover, LVP is water-resistant, meaning it can withstand spills and moisture better than traditional hardwood flooring. This durability is one reason homeowners often choose LVP for kitchens and bathrooms.

Yes, LVP flooring can support heavy furniture, but it’s essential to use furniture pads and avoid dragging items to prevent damage.
With proper care, LVP flooring can last anywhere from 15 to 25 years, depending on the quality of the product and maintenance.
Most LVP flooring is water-resistant, but it’s advisable to check the manufacturer’s specifications to confirm its waterproof capabilities.
Yes, LVP can often be installed over existing flooring, provided the surface is level and in good condition.
Minor scratches can often be buffed out with a soft cloth. For deeper scratches, you may need to use a repair kit designed for vinyl flooring.
